Calcium phosphate cement(CPC)is a promising candidate for orthopedic clinical applications such as bone graft or substitution due to its high moldability,bioactivity,and biocompatibility.However,CPC has a number of problems including high brittleness,poor injectability,long setting time and low compressive strength,all of which seriously restrict its application in the repair of load-bearing bones,especially in the minimally invasive surgery of fractured vertebrae(also known as kyphoplasty).
